We just received our 2021 updates. Other than being able to share what's new that's going to be available I know no details as I have not seen anything 1st hand

VX-3HD 1.5-5x20 (1 inch) CDS-ZL Duplex

VX-3HD 1.5-5x20 (30 mm) CDS-ZL Illum. FireDot Twilight Hunter

VX-3HD 2.5-8x36 (1 inch) CDS-ZL Duplex

VX-3HD 3.5-10x40 (1 inch) CDS-ZL Duplex

VX-3HD 3.5-10x40 (30 mm) CDS-ZL Illum. FireDot Twilight Hunter

VX-3HD 3.5-10x50 (1 inch) CDS-ZL Duplex

VX-3HD 3.5-10x50 (30 mm) CDS-ZL Illum. FireDot Twilight Hunter

VX-3HD 4.5-14x40 (1 inch) CDS-ZL Duplex

VX-3HD 4.5-14x40 (1 inch) CDS-ZL Boone & Crockett

VX-3HD 4.5-14x40 (30 mm) Side Focus CDS-ZL Wind-Plex

VX-3HD 4.5-14x40 (1 inch) CDS-ZL Wind-Plex Burnt Bronze

VX-3HD 4.5-14x50 (1 inch) CDS-ZL Duplex

VX-3HD 4.5-14x50 (30 mm) CDS-ZL Illum. FireDot Twilight Hunter

VX-3HD 6.5-20x40 (1 inch) EFR CDS-TZL2 Fine Duplex

VX-3HD 6.5-20x50 (30 mm) Side Focus CDS-TZL2 Fine Duplex

VX-Freedom 1.5-4x20 (1 inch) MOA-Ring

VX-Freedom 2-7x33 (1 inch) Hunt-Plex

VX-Freedom 3-9x40 (1 inch) Hunt-Plex

VX-Freedom 3-9x40 (1 inch) CDS Tri-MOA

VX-Freedom 3-9x50 (1 inch) CDS Duplex

VX-Freedom 4-12x40 (1 inch) CDS Duplex

VX-Freedom 4-12x40 (1 inch) CDS Tri-MOA

VX-Freedom 4-12x50 (1 inch) CDS Duplex

Mark 3HD 1.5-4x20 (30mm) AR-Ballistic

Mark 3HD 1.5-4x20 (30mm) Illum. FireDot SPR

Mark 3HD 1.5-4x20 (30mm) Illum. FireDot BDC

Mark 3HD 1.5-4x20 (30mm) P5 Illum. FireDot TMR

Mark 3HD 3-9x40 (30mm) P5 MilDot

Mark 3HD 3-9x40 (30mm) P5 Illum. FireDot TMR

Mark 3HD 4-12x40 (30mm) P5 Illum. FireDot TMR

Mark 3HD 4-12x40 (30mm) P5 Side Focus TMR

Mark 3HD 6-18x50 (30mm) P5 Side Focus TMR

Mark 3HD 8-24x50 (30mm) P5 Side Focus TMR
